>That means that the driver is not TS compatible, like many 3rd
>party drivers.
>
>Installing 3rd party drivers is *not* recommended on a TS, because
>non-compatible drivers have a nasty habit to crash your print
>spooler or the whole server. Uninstall the Lexmark driver and
>instead map the printer to a native driver, like a HP LaserJet 4,
>by creating a custom ntprintsubs.inf file.
>
>Details here:
>
>239088 - Windows 2000 Terminal Services Server Logs Events 1111,
>1105, and 1106
>http://support.microsoft.com/?kbid=239088
